Brothers and sisters, get excited – Brisbane's finest music festival will take the stage on Saturday 31 January 2015.


Having celebrated its 10th anniversary this year, the annual St. Jerome's Laneway Festival, or simple Laneway, will grace the Brisbane Showgrounds once again next year.

The festival was first launched in 2004 in an laneway of Melbourne's CBD, when Danny Rogers and Jerome Borazio threw a party and decided to call it a festival in a "colourful alley". (Sounds like these guys know how to throw one big street party).

Since bringing Caledonian Lane to life back in 2004, Laneway has hosted and boasted some of the most famous artists in the world. This legendary festival has also propelled some of our local Aussie artists to international fame, including indie rock band The Jezabels and Australian quartet Miami Horror.


Next year's lineup will include: Agnes DeMarco, Andy Bull, Angel Olsen, BANKS, Benjamin Booker, Caribou, Connan Mockasin, Courtney Barnett, Dune Rats, Eagulls, Eves, FKA Twigs, Flight Facilities, Flying Lotus (Layer 3), Future Islands, Highasakite, Jesse Davidson, Jon Hopkins, Jungle, Little Dragon, Lykke Li, Mac DeMarco, Mansionair, Perfect, Pussy, Peter Bibby, POND, Ratking, Raury, Royal Blood, Rustie, Seekae, SOHN, St Vincent and last but not least Vic Mensa.

Laneway is known for its party scene of music, drink and food (not unlike many music festivals), but what makes this festival different and special is that it has spread across seven cities and three countries – Australia, New Zealand and Singapore. This allows variety and gives a rather unique legacy to Laneway.
